Goupil: A Monte Carlo engine for the backward transport of low-energy gamma-rays

被引:0
作者
Niess, Valentin [1 ]
Vernet, Kinson [1 ]
Terray, Luca [1 ,2 ]
机构
[1] Univ Clermont Auvergne, CNRS, LPCA, F-63000 Clermont Ferrand, France
[2] Univ Clermont Auvergne, CNRS, Lab Magmas & Volcans, IRD ,OPGC, F-63000 Clermont Ferrand, France
关键词
Gamma-rays; Monte Carlo; Transport; Backward; CROSS-SECTIONS; SIMULATION; SPECTROMETRY; SCATTERING; ELECTRONS; RADIATION; GEANT4; TOOL;
D O I
10.1016/j.cpc.2025.109653
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
GouPIL is a software library designed for the Monte Carlo transport of low-energy gamma-rays, such as those emitted from radioactive isotopes. The library is distributed as a Python module. It implements a dedicated backward sampling algorithm that is highly effective for geometries where the source size largely exceeds the detector size. When used in conjunction with a conventional Monte Carlo engine (i.e., GEANT4), the response of a scintillation detector to gamma-active radio-isotopes scattered over the environment is accurately simulated (to the nearest percent) while achieving events rates of a few kHz (with a similar to 2.3 GHz CPU).
引用
收藏
页数:16
相关论文
共 53 条
[1]   GEANT4-a simulation toolkit [J].
Agostinelli, S ;
Allison, J ;
Amako, K ;
Apostolakis, J ;
Araujo, H ;
Arce, P ;
Asai, M ;
Axen, D ;
Banerjee, S ;
Barrand, G ;
Behner, F ;
Bellagamba, L ;
Boudreau, J ;
Broglia, L ;
Brunengo, A ;
Burkhardt, H ;
Chauvie, S ;
Chuma, J ;
Chytracek, R ;
Cooperman, G ;
Cosmo, G ;
Degtyarenko, P ;
Dell'Acqua, A ;
Depaola, G ;
Dietrich, D ;
Enami, R ;
Feliciello, A ;
Ferguson, C ;
Fesefeldt, H ;
Folger, G ;
Foppiano, F ;
Forti, A ;
Garelli, S ;
Giani, S ;
Giannitrapani, R ;
Gibin, D ;
Cadenas, JJG ;
González, I ;
Abril, GG ;
Greeniaus, G ;
Greiner, W ;
Grichine, V ;
Grossheim, A ;
Guatelli, S ;
Gumplinger, P ;
Hamatsu, R ;
Hashimoto, K ;
Hasui, H ;
Heikkinen, A ;
Howard, A .
NUCLEAR INSTRUMENTS & METHODS IN PHYSICS RESEARCH SECTION A-ACCELERATORS SPECTROMETERS DETECTORS AND ASSOCIATED EQUIPMENT, 2003, 506 (03) :250-303
[2]   Geant4 developments and applications [J].
Allison, J ;
Amako, K ;
Apostolakis, J ;
Araujo, H ;
Dubois, PA ;
Asai, M ;
Barrand, G ;
Capra, R ;
Chauvie, S ;
Chytracek, R ;
Cirrone, GAP ;
Cooperman, G ;
Cosmo, G ;
Cuttone, G ;
Daquino, GG ;
Donszelmann, M ;
Dressel, M ;
Folger, G ;
Foppiano, F ;
Generowicz, J ;
Grichine, V ;
Guatelli, S ;
Gumplinger, P ;
Heikkinen, A ;
Hrivnacova, I ;
Howard, A ;
Incerti, S ;
Ivanchenko, V ;
Johnson, T ;
Jones, F ;
Koi, T ;
Kokoulin, R ;
Kossov, M ;
Kurashige, H ;
Lara, V ;
Larsson, S ;
Lei, F ;
Link, O ;
Longo, F ;
Maire, M ;
Mantero, A ;
Mascialino, B ;
McLaren, I ;
Lorenzo, PM ;
Minamimoto, K ;
Murakami, K ;
Nieminen, P ;
Pandola, L ;
Parlati, S ;
Peralta, L .
IEEE TRANSACTIONS ON NUCLEAR SCIENCE, 2006, 53 (01) :270-278
[3]   Recent developments in GEANT4 [J].
Allison, J. ;
Amako, K. ;
Apostolakis, J. ;
Arce, P. ;
Asai, M. ;
Aso, T. ;
Bagli, E. ;
Bagulya, A. ;
Banerjee, S. ;
Barrand, G. ;
Beck, B. R. ;
Bogdanov, A. G. ;
Brandt, D. ;
Brown, J. M. C. ;
Burkhardt, H. ;
Canal, Ph. ;
Cano-Ott, D. ;
Chauvie, S. ;
Cho, K. ;
Cirrone, G. A. P. ;
Cooperman, G. ;
Cortes-Giraldo, M. A. ;
Cosmo, G. ;
Cuttone, G. ;
Depaola, G. ;
Desorgher, L. ;
Dong, X. ;
Dotti, A. ;
Elvira, V. D. ;
Folger, G. ;
Francis, Z. ;
Galoyan, A. ;
Garnier, L. ;
Gayer, M. ;
Genser, K. L. ;
Grichine, V. M. ;
Guatelli, S. ;
Gueye, P. ;
Gumplinger, P. ;
Howard, A. S. ;
Hrivnacova, I. ;
Hwang, S. ;
Incerti, S. ;
Ivanchenko, A. ;
Ivanchenko, V. N. ;
Jones, F. W. ;
Jun, S. Y. ;
Kaitaniemi, P. ;
Karakatsanis, N. ;
Karamitrosi, M. .
NUCLEAR INSTRUMENTS & METHODS IN PHYSICS RESEARCH SECTION A-ACCELERATORS SPECTROMETERS DETECTORS AND ASSOCIATED EQUIPMENT, 2016, 835 :186-225
[4]   In situ γ-ray spectrometry in the marine environment using full spectrum analysis for natural radionuclides [J].
Androulakaki, E. G. ;
Kokkoris, M. ;
Tsabaris, C. ;
Eleftheriou, G. ;
Patiris, D. L. ;
Pappa, F. K. ;
Vlastou, R. .
APPLIED RADIATION AND ISOTOPES, 2016, 114 :76-86
[5]  
[Anonymous], 2015, PENELOPE 2014 CODE S, DOI DOI 10.1787/4-3F14DB-EN
[6]  
[Anonymous], 2023, Rust Programming Language
[7]  
[Anonymous], 2024, Mesocentre Clermont-Auvergne
[8]  
[Anonymous], 2024, PYTHON PACKAGE INDEX
[9]  
[Anonymous], 2023, EPICS
[10]  
[Anonymous], 2024, Github, Goupil